All the posts above provide great advice. Autoeurope has been a good source for us. e.g., this past summer we rented a car with them for 12 days with pickup at Munich and drop off in Graz, Austria. The first price quote was just under $1,000 USD. After looking that various options (using my credit card that provided coverage) I was able to get the car foe $625 (note: it was an intermediate with stick). Look for alternative pickup and dropoff locations. Airport and train stations are more.


Don't hestiate to try and deal with the care rental. Keep pressing them for a discount. We were able to be sucessful.
